Green Tea with Seaweed
Green tea from China, natural essences of mint, Nanah mint leaves and seaweeds (Nori, Dulse and Sea Lettuce)
Tasting advice: delicious plain or sweetened.
The virtues of green tea and mint with the benefits of seaweeds (minerals, vitamins, draining properties) make this refreshing tonic the ideal aid for slimming diets.
TEA PROFILE
Origin: China and Brittany
Main Flavor: Oceanic with a fresh note
Quantity Needed: 0,1 oz.PREPARATION
Time of Day: all day
Ideal Water Temperature: 85°C
Recommended Brewing Time: 3-4 min
